在本教學中,我們將介紹學習Meteor核心API。
如果你想限制代碼只在伺服器或客戶端可以使用下麵的代碼運行 -
meteorApp.js
if (Meteor.isClient) {
// Code running on client...
}
if (Meteor.isServer) {
// Code running on server...
}
您可以限制代碼運行,只有在應用程式使用Cordova捆綁時可使用。
if (Meteor.isCordova) {
// Code running on Cordova...
}
一些插件需要等到伺服器和DOM已準備就緒。您可以使用下麵的代碼等待直至一切都開始。
Meteor.startup(function () {
// Code running after platform is ready...
});
還有其他核心API的方法。您可以在下表中查看。
| S.No. | 方法和詳細 |
|---|---|
| 1 |
Meteor.wrapAsync(function)
用於包裝非同步代碼並將其轉換成同步。
|
| 2 |
Meteor.absoluteUrl([path], [options])
用於生成絕對URL指向的應用程式。
|
| 3 |
Meteor.settings
用於設置部署配置。
|
| 4 |
Meteor.publish(name, function)
用於發佈記錄客戶端。
|
上一篇:
Meteor軟體包管理
下一篇:
Meteor check
